First Solar's stock price surged to a multiyear high on May 28 as investors anticipated the US government's upcoming decision on Section 232 tariffs affecting solar imports. The tariff announcement could impact the solar industry's cost structure and competitive landscape in the United States. This development matters for solar manufacturers, consumers, and the broader renewable energy market.
